Find your future with us.The Senior Manager – Air Dominance is responsible for sales and marketing efforts based in Berkeley, MO, Arlington, VA, Eglin AFB, FL or Nellis AFB, NV.The position is a senior manager role and the incumbent will be part of a team of marketing and sales professionals for the F-15. This position supports that continued success through direct customer engagement and anticipation of future capability needs.Position Responsibilities:

Manages employees and first-level managers planning, developing and managing sales and marketing campaigns.

Develops and executes integrated departmental plans, policies and procedures and provides input on departmental business and technical strategies, goals, objectives.

Acquires resources for department activities, provides technical management of suppliers and leads process improvements.

Develops and maintains relationships and partnerships with customers, stakeholders, peers, partners and direct reports.

Provides oversight and approval of technical approaches, products and processes.

Manages, develops and motivates employees and first-level managers.

This position is hybrid. This means that the selected candidate will be required to perform some work onsite at one of the listed location options. This is at the hiring team’s discretion and could potentially change in the future.This position requires an active U.S. Secret Security Clearance (U.S. Citizenship Required). (A U.S. Security Clearance that has been active in the past 24 months is considered active)Basic Qualifications (Required Skills/Experience)

Bachelor's Degree or higher

Experience with USAF (U.S. Air Force) and DoD (Department of Defense) requirements, PPBE (Planning, Programming, Budget and Execution) and/or acquisition processes

Extensive demonstrable experience fostering relationships and influencing senior level executives

Preferred Qualifications (Desired Skills/Experience)

Experience in the aerospace and defense industry

Experience in Business Development
